Biological Safety Testing Product and Services Market on Track for Historic Expansion and Untapped Potential

The Biological Safety Testing Products and Services Market  size was valued at USD 4.37 billion in 2023. The market is anticipated to grow from USD 4.84 billion in 2024 to USD 11.16 billion by 2032, exhibiting a CAGR of 11.0% during the forecast period. This growth is fueled by the increasing production of biopharmaceuticals, rising concerns about biological contamination, and strict regulatory guidelines for the safety and efficacy of biological products.

Market Overview

Biological safety testing ensures that pharmaceutical and biotechnological products are free from contamination and safe for human use. It plays a vital role in the development and commercialization of biopharmaceuticals, vaccines, and other biological products. The growing demand for biologics, increasing R&D investments, and the prevalence of chronic diseases are expanding the market for biological safety testing.

The market includes both products (such as kits, reagents, and instruments) and services (testing for endotoxins, sterility, bioburden, and cell line authentication). The push for regulatory compliance from agencies like the FDA, EMA, and WHO is compelling companies to adopt robust biological safety protocols, further driving market growth.

Key Market Growth Drivers

1. Rise in Biopharmaceutical Production
The rapid growth of the biopharmaceutical industry, especially in monoclonal antibodies, cell and gene therapies, and recombinant proteins, is significantly increasing the need for biological safety testing at every stage of development and manufacturing.

2. Stringent Regulatory Guidelines
Regulatory agencies worldwide mandate extensive biological safety testing to ensure product quality and safety. Compliance with GMP (Good Manufacturing Practices) and regulatory standards like ICH and ISO 13485 is driving demand for both products and outsourced services.

3. Increase in Outsourcing of Testing Services
Pharmaceutical and biotech companies are increasingly outsourcing safety testing to specialized CROs (Contract Research Organizations) and CDMOs (Contract Development and Manufacturing Organizations) to reduce cost and accelerate time to market.

4. Rising Incidence of Chronic and Infectious Diseases
The surge in chronic illnesses and pandemics has spurred vaccine and biologic drug development, creating heightened demand for stringent safety and efficacy testing before clinical and commercial release.

5. Technological Advancements in Testing Methods
Innovations in testing technology, including rapid microbiology testing, PCR-based assays, and automated instruments, are enhancing the speed, accuracy, and reliability of biological safety testing, thus encouraging adoption.

Market Challenges

1. High Cost of Testing and Instruments
Advanced safety testing equipment and reagents involve significant capital investment. Small and mid-sized biotech firms often struggle with these costs, limiting adoption in certain regions.

2. Complex Regulatory Landscape
Different regions have diverse and often complex regulatory requirements, which can pose challenges for global companies in standardizing safety testing protocols.

3. Limited Availability of Skilled Professionals
Biological safety testing requires trained professionals and specialized laboratories. A shortage of skilled personnel can hinder testing efficiency and quality.

4. Risk of Contamination and False Results
Improper handling or substandard testing methods can lead to false results, causing regulatory setbacks, product recalls, and damage to brand reputation.

Regional Analysis

North America holds the largest share of the biological safety testing products and services market due to strong government funding, presence of major pharmaceutical players, and a robust regulatory framework. The U.S. is the leading contributor, driven by extensive biologics R&D and the presence of top CROs.

Europe is the second-largest market, led by countries such as Germany, the UK, and France. The region benefits from a growing biopharma sector, government funding for biotech research, and adherence to strict safety standards.

Asia-Pacific is expected to witness the fastest growth during the forecast period. The expansion of pharmaceutical manufacturing in India, China, South Korea, and Japan, combined with improving healthcare infrastructure and rising investment in biosafety testing, is driving regional market growth.

Latin America and Middle East & Africa are emerging markets, benefiting from expanding biopharma capabilities and international partnerships for vaccine development and biologic manufacturing.
